Popcorn Pops

2009 Schedule with the Columbus Symphony Orchestra

Music is fun! Perennial Popcorn Pops conductor Albert-George Schram, packs these shorter Picnic with the Pops concerts with humor, joy and music that will make kids of all ages dance around. So pack up a picnic, lawn chairs or blankets and head out for an evening under the stars with Columbus Symphony Orchestra.
Where: Chemical Abstracts Service lawn, on Olentangy River Rd, north of the Ohio State University campus. Note: These are outdoor concerts.
Time: 8 p.m., but get there at least an hour before to score a good spot and set up your picnic.
Cost: $12 lawn tickets. Buy tickets online.

Schedule

July 10, 8 p.m.
“George Goes Jungle”

July 17, 8 p.m.
“Remarkable Farkle”

July 24, 8 p.m.
“Symphonic Stew”
